Alanta
Alanta is a small town in Molėtai district municipality, Lithuania. It is the administrative seat of the Alanta Elderate. According to a census in 2011, Alanta had 348 residents.| Tap on a place to explore it |

Synagogue of Alanta
Photo: Emma Cornelia Jerusalem, CC BY-SA 4.0.
The Synagogue of Alanta is a former Jewish congregation and synagogue, located at 3a Ukmergės Street, in Alanta, in the Molėtai District Municipality, in the Utena County of Lithuania.
